WORLD EXPERIENCE OF THE SPHERE OF COMMODITY SOCIAL AND ECONOMIC MODERNIZATION STATE POLICY PROVIDING

Journal Title: ЕКОНОМІЧНИЙ ДИСКУРС - Year 2018, Vol 1, Issue 4

Abstract

The institutional environment, which is formed through the adoption of relevant rules and regulations, is an important element in ensuring the social and economic modernization of the sphere of commodity circulation. Domestic legislation regulating the functioning and modernization of the sphere of commodity circulation is imperfect and requires new approaches to the system of regulation of this sphere and introduction of the most successful practices of the leading countries of the world. In the process of research used methods – abstract and logical, scientific abstraction (to deepen the concepts and categories, disclosure of the essential characteristics of government and its features in trade); institutional and evolutionary (for the disclosure of the genesis of commodity circulation in different countries, policies of state regulation of processes of modernization of support for entrepreneurial activity); systematization and generalizations (for revealing structural changes, new trends and vectors of commodity circulation development and the system of state regulation). The analysis of the experience of the leading countries in the field of regulating the processes of modernization of the sphere of commodity circulation shows common approaches for most countries, which include: liberalization of commodity circulation; intensification of foreign economic activity and export activation; creation of innovative products; development of high-tech industries; activation of Internet commerce and state regulation of e-commerce. The modern economy cannot function without the influence of state institutions and requires appropriate methodological and methodological tools for regulating modernization processes, including in the field of commodity circulation, therefore, the study of successful foreign experience in the field of state regulation of modernization processes is perspective and requires further scientific developments.
